Video Transcript

"My name is Wes Rhodes, I'm from the Chinese Kung Fu Academy and for Expert Village and this is how you perform Mantis fighting technique Inside Block Shin Kick. Now this technique is done using the left forearm to block. Sit back, block with the left arm, pick the right knee up and drive your foot into their shin. Step forward, slowly, one, two. A little faster is, one, two, just like that. Now you need to make sure the block comes first and then follow through with the kick. To demonstrate. As they step in and punch with the right hand, you sit back, pick the foot up and drive the foot into their shin. Do one slow, one two. One a little faster. One, two. Now, let's say they're pretty good. They step in and punch, as I kick, they pick the leg up, so I switch, boom, hit with the other leg. So this way no matter how good they think they are, you can still get them with it. Do one more slow. One, say, one, two. One little faster. One, two, that's it, just like that. Now remember, when you drive the foot out, keep the hip, the knee and the foot in line with the target on both kicks. You can use this technique either on the right side or the left side. It's very important to make sure you practice getting the block proper first. One, "so you punch with the other side. Punch with the other side", so one, and you drive the foot in one, and then you could actually kick with the other one too, two. Just like that. That's how you perform Praying Mantis fighting technique Inside Block Shin Kick."
